A Tale in the Desert: Beta Report, Part 2
   

Val took another trip into the hot deserts of Egypt and gives us another inside look into the wonderfull world of A Tale in the Desert. This time she covers the the various disciplines and mechanics of the game.<ul><i>There are many Schools in Egypt. There is one for each of the Disciplines as well as a University. The difference between Universities and Schools is that technology needs to be researched at Universities and that skills taught at Universities are free for all to learn. For skills to be researched at Universities, players must donate the required materials for the technology to be unlocked. You can choose to donate materials to the various Universities for more technologies to be unlocked. Thus all of Egypt gets advanced through the efforts of individual players working together.</i></ul>Read the full report <a href='http://www.rpgdot.com/index.php?hsaction=10053&ID=507'>here</a>.
